I've been driving my Kia ProCeed for a few years and I'm wondering if it's time to change the transmission fluid. How often should this be done and what is the best method to use?
ReplyChanging the transmission fluid is an essential part of vehicle maintenance and should be done every 30,000-60,000 miles. For the Kia ProCeed, it is recommended to change the fluid every 60,000 miles. To ensure the best results, it is important to use the specific transmission fluid recommended by Kia for your vehicle, which can be found in your owner's manual.
Changing the transmission fluid in a Kia ProCeed is a relatively simple process that can be done at home. First, gather all the necessary tools and equipment. Next, locate the transmission fluid pan and drain the old fluid. Then, replace the old filter and refill the transmission with the recommended fluid. For a more detailed guide, refer to your owner's manual.
It's important to regularly change the transmission fluid in your Kia ProCeed to maintain the smooth operation and longevity of your vehicle. Neglecting this maintenance can result in costly repairs in the future. If you are unsure about how to change the fluid or do not have the necessary tools, it is best to take your car to a trusted mechanic for professional service.
